How to Train Like a Sepak Takraw World Cup Champion

Training like a Sepak Takraw World Cup champion requires dedication and a well-structured regimen. Begin with warm-up exercises that prepare your muscles and joints. Incorporate dynamic stretching to improve flexibility and prevent injuries. Focus on footwork drills that simulate match conditions. Consider agility ladders or cone drills to enhance your quickness. Strength training should also be incorporated to build stamina and power. Exercises like squats, lunges, and deadlifts are essential for leg strength. From a cardiovascular perspective, running or cycling can improve endurance, allowing champions to maintain high levels of play throughout matches. Communicate effectively with your teammates during training to develop strong coordination. Regularly practice key techniques such as serves, spikes, and blocks. This allows players to master their skills and makes them more versatile. Don’t forget the importance of cool down and recovery. Stretching after workouts helps maintain flexibility and assists muscle recovery. Adequate hydration, nutrition, and rest are crucial components in a champion’s training program.

Exercise variety is critical for success in Sepak Takraw, as athletes face different challenges during competitions. Mix up your training routine to keep things fresh, engaging, and exciting. Devote time to practicing specific techniques and skills. Foot-eye coordination plays a crucial role; therefore, striking the ball using both feet should become second nature. Consider working with a coach or attending workshops to refine your skills. Learning from experienced players can reveal various strategies that benefit aspiring champions. Also, implement video analysis of your performances, examining strengths and weaknesses objectively. Analyzing footage can help you identify areas needing improvement or adjustment. Focus on developing a tactical understanding of opponent gameplay, which can differentiate top players. Incorporate scenarios in training that mimic match situations, allowing you to practice under pressure. Always emphasize communication with teammates, as effective play is contingent on collective efforts. Regularly participate in friendly matches or tournaments, as gaining competitive experience fosters players’ growth and adaptation. All these components work together, ultimately propelling you towards becoming a more capable contender in the Sepak Takraw World Cup.

Nutrition for Elite Performance

A crucial factor in training success for a Sepak Takraw champion is maintaining a proper nutrition plan. Fueling your body with the right nutrients can significantly enhance performance and recovery. Prioritize a balanced diet enriched with carbohydrates, proteins, and healthy fats. Carbohydrates provide the necessary energy for high-intensity training and competitions. Include whole grains, fruits, and vegetables, optimizing glycogen stores. Proteins play a vital role in muscle repair and growth, consuming lean meats, fish, eggs, or plant-based proteins will support recovery processes. Healthy fats help maintain stamina during prolonged sessions; nuts, seeds, and avocados can keep energy levels up. Moreover, hydration cannot be overlooked; it is essential to stay hydrated throughout training. Aim for at least two liters of water daily and supplement with electrolytes after intense workouts. Planning meals and snacks around training can optimize energy levels, ensuring you perform at your best. Consider consulting with a sports nutritionist to develop a personalized plan tailored to individual needs. Nutrition is foundational to supporting rigorous training and achieving top performance in competitive environments.

Mental preparation is another critical aspect of training like a Sepak Takraw champion. Focus on developing a strong mental attitude as it often distinguishes elite athletes from amateur ones. Visualization techniques can enhance performance; practice imagining successful plays and scenarios in your mind. Positive affirmations help build confidence and resilience, reminding you of your capabilities and strengths. Employ mindfulness exercises such as meditation or yoga to improve focus and reduce performance anxiety. Tension often arises in crucial matches, making it essential to navigate mental challenges effectively. Set achievable goals and milestones throughout your training journey, instilling motivation and a sense of purpose. Regular self-evaluation can also help you track your progress, enabling adjustments in your training. Collaborate with a sports psychologist if desired; they can provide invaluable insights and strategies for mental fortitude. Remember that both physical and mental training are intertwined. Fostering a strong mental game complements your physical prowess, enhancing overall performance. Engage with teammates to create a supportive and encouraging environment, fostering camaraderie. Cultivating strong bonds with fellow players can motivate individual growth and enhance overall team dynamics.

Injury Prevention Strategies

Injury prevention is crucial in maintaining consistent training intensity and duration. Champions must prioritize their bodies and employ various strategies to minimize injury risks. Begin with proper warm-up routines to ensure muscles are ready for the physical demands ahead. Incorporate flexibility exercises into your regimen to enhance joint mobility and coordination. Listen to your body; if you feel discomfort or fatigue, take a step back and rest. Implement progressive overload in your workouts to build strength over time instead of risking injury through excessive strain. Consider cross-training activities to strengthen complementary muscle groups without overworking specific areas. Additionally, consult professionals like physiotherapists for detailed assessments and targeted rehabilitation exercises if needed. Emphasize proper footwear; wearing shoes designed for Sepak Takraw can reduce joint stresses and enhance stability. Strong core muscles improve balance, further diminishing the chances of falls or missteps during gameplay. Understanding the mechanics of each movement aids in training; practicing proper technique ensures reduced injury risks. Ultimately, a well-rounded approach to injury prevention contributes significantly to performing consistently at high levels.

Building effective teamwork is essential in Sepak Takraw, as successful matches rely heavily on communication and strategy. Develop strong relationships with teammates both on and off the court. Trust amongst players fosters enhanced performance, allowing for seamless communication during matches. Conduct team-building exercises that create camaraderie and understanding among members. Regularly discuss strategies and tactics to ensure that everyone is on the same page, fostering a unified approach to gameplay. Observing and analyzing other successful teams can provide valuable insights into potential strategies and teamwork dynamics. Implement drills that involve cooperative workflows, focusing on passes and scoring during practice sessions. Acknowledge individual strengths and skill sets, ensuring that each player is positioned in alignment with their abilities in competitive matches. Periodically reviewing game footage as a team can also help identify areas for improvement in communication and coordination. Emphasize open dialogue during matches, ensuring teammates support one another, especially during challenging situations. Nurturing a positive atmosphere encourages players to feel empowered and contribute their best efforts, ultimately driving the team’s success. Collective synergy is vital in achieving glory at the Sepak Takraw World Cup.
